Course Overview
The Biomedical Engineering program at the University of Illinois at Urbana-Champaign is designed to integrate engineering principles with biological and medical sciences to address challenges in healthcare and medicine. The curriculum emphasizes hands-on learning, research, and innovation, preparing students to design medical devices, develop diagnostic tools, and improve healthcare systems. Unique features include a focus on interdisciplinary collaboration and access to cutting-edge research opportunities.
Career Prospects
Graduates of this program are well-equipped for careers in medical device design, biotechnology, healthcare consulting, and research. Many pursue roles in industry, academia, or clinical settings, contributing to advancements in patient care and medical technology.

Unique Facilities and Partnerships
Students benefit from state-of-the-art facilities, including specialized laboratories for biomaterials and medical imaging. The university maintains strong partnerships with local hospitals, research institutes, and industry leaders, providing opportunities for internships and collaborative projects.
